Journey information
Overview: Berlin to Naples flight
Flights from Berlin to Naples depart on average 50 times per day, taking around 3h 28m. Cheap flight tickets for this journey start at £67 if you book in advance.
There are 1 flights per day. The earliest flight runs at 00:06, the last at 22:40. The fastest flight covers the 1302 km distance in 2h 0m. May is the cheapest month to fly.
Distance 1302 km |
Average flight duration 3h 28m |
Cheapest ticket price £67 |
Flights per day 50 |
Direct flights 1 |
Fastest flight 2h 0m |
Cheapest month to travel May |
First flight 00:06 |
Last flight 22:40 |
The cheapest and fastest flights from Berlin to Naples
Cheapest price
£231
Average price
£622
Fastest journey
2 h 10 m
Average duration
3 h 49 m
Flights per day
65
Distance
1302 km
The best way to find a cheap flight ticket from Berlin to Naples is to book your journey as far in advance as possible and to avoid travelling at rush hour.
The average ticket from Berlin to Naples will cost around £622 if you buy it on the day, but you can find cheap flight tickets today for only £231.
Of the 65 flights that leave Berlin for Naples every day 1 travel direct so it’s quite easy to avoid journeys where you’ll have to change along the way.
These direct flights cover the 1302 km distance in an average of 3 h 49 m but if you time it right, some flights will get you there in just 2 h 10 m .
The slowest flights will take 4 h 35 m and usually involve a change or two along the way, but you might be able to save a few pennies if you’re on a budget.
FR 9164+
V71621
U24265
U25079+
Leonardo express 4709+
FRECCIAROSSA 1000 8223
U25079+
Leonardo express 4681+
FRECCIAROSSA 9435
U25079+
Leonardo express 4679+
FRECCIAROSSA 9661
U24265
LH4079 · LH4144
OS230 · OS573
LX975 · LX1710
LH189 · LH336Travel Information
Compare train, coach and flight for Berlin to Naples
Omio recommends booking the flight as it is the most popular option from Berlin to Naples among Omio's users. If you are prioritising price take the coach with prices starting from £82. For those with little time consider booking a flight which can get you there in 3h 28m. In case you are seeking to minimise your carbon footprint the train is your best bet as it emits only 0.4 - 1.2kg. The ticket price range depends on the travel mode: a coach costs an average of £82, and a train costs an average of £258.
Distance: 1302 km
Compare flight with
Most popular Flight | Train | Coach |
|---|---|---|
£193 Average Price | £259 Average Price | £128 Average Price Cheapest |
6h 28m Average total duration Fastest 3h 28m Onboard + 3h 0m Additional time* | 16h 53m Average total duration 16h 23m Onboard + 30m Additional time* | 25h 17m Average total duration 24h 47m Onboard + 30m Additional time* |
3.9 - 7.8kg CO2 emissions | 0.4 - 1.2kg CO2 emissions Lowest | 1.3 - 3.3kg CO2 emissions |
![]() Most popular airline | ![]() Most popular train company | ![]() Most popular bus company |
Direct Options | Direct Options | Direct Options |
Additional time: Average total travel duration to departure point, security checks and transfers.
Live departures
Berlin to Naples flight times
The table below shows live departures for Berlin to Naples flights for today, Saturday 20 December. You can also manually refresh the results below to see updated flight journeys.
| Provider | Departs | Duration | Arrives | Changes | Tickets |
|---|---|---|---|---|---|
LH2207 · LH1878 | 12:00 Berlin Brandenburg Airport | 4h25 | 16:25 Naples International Airport | 1 change | |
OS228 · OS557+ OS6655 | 12:15 Berlin Brandenburg Airport | 9h25 | 21:40 Naples International Airport | 2 changes | |
LH191+ LH5148+ Leonardo express 4709+ FRECCIAROSSA 1000 8223 | 13:40 Berlin Brandenburg Airport | 9h18 | 22:58 Naples Centrale | 3 changes | |
LH191+ LH5148 · LH5124 | 13:40 Berlin Brandenburg Airport | 8h00 | 21:40 Naples International Airport | 2 changes | |
LH191+ LH5148+ Leonardo express 4681+ FRECCIAROSSA 9435 | 13:40 Berlin Brandenburg Airport | 9h08 | 22:48 Naples Centrale | 3 changes | |
LH191+ LH5148+ Leonardo express 4679+ FRECCIAROSSA 9661 | 13:40 Berlin Brandenburg Airport | 8h53 | 22:33 Naples Centrale | 3 changes | |
U22984+ Regionale 20731+ Intercity 597 | 13:50 Berlin Brandenburg Airport | 8h44 | 22:34 Naples Centrale | 2 changes | |
U22984+ Leonardo express 4663+ FRECCIAROSSA 9551 | 13:50 Berlin Brandenburg Airport | 6h23 | 20:13 Naples Centrale | 2 changes | |
U22984+ Leonardo express 4659+ FRECCIAROSSA 1000 9427 | 13:50 Berlin Brandenburg Airport | 5h58 | 19:48 Naples Centrale | 2 changes | |
OS230 · OS557+ Leonardo express 4675+ FRECCIAROSSA 9657 | 14:10 Berlin Brandenburg Airport | 7h53 | 22:03 Naples Centrale | 3 changes | |
OS230 · OS557+ Leonardo express 4673+ FRECCIAROSSA 1000 9653 | 14:10 Berlin Brandenburg Airport | 7h23 | 21:33 Naples Centrale | 3 changes | |
OS230 · OS557+ OS6655 | 14:10 Berlin Brandenburg Airport | 7h30 | 21:40 Naples International Airport | 2 changes | |
OS230 · OS557+ Leonardo express 4679+ FRECCIAROSSA 9661 | 14:10 Berlin Brandenburg Airport | 8h23 | 22:33 Naples Centrale | 3 changes | |
LH193+ LH5148+ Leonardo express 4681+ FRECCIAROSSA 9435 | 14:40 Berlin Brandenburg Airport | 8h08 | 22:48 Naples Centrale | 3 changes | |
LH193+ LH5148 · LH5124 | 14:40 Berlin Brandenburg Airport | 7h00 | 21:40 Naples International Airport | 2 changes | |
LH193+ LH5148+ Leonardo express 4709+ FRECCIAROSSA 1000 8223 | 14:40 Berlin Brandenburg Airport | 8h18 | 22:58 Naples Centrale | 3 changes | |
LH193+ LH5148+ Leonardo express 4679+ FRECCIAROSSA 9661 | 14:40 Berlin Brandenburg Airport | 7h53 | 22:33 Naples Centrale | 3 changes | |
VY1885 · VY6502 | 14:45 Berlin Brandenburg Airport | 5h55 | 20:40 Naples International Airport | 1 change | |
VY1887 · VY6500 | 20:20 Berlin Brandenburg Airport | 11h45 | 08:05 Naples International Airport | 1 change | |
| Sunday 21 December | |||||
LH1959+ LH4144 | 06:00 Berlin Brandenburg Airport | 5h30 | 11:30 Naples International Airport | 1 change | |
LH1959 · LH1866+ Leonardo express 4623+ FRECCIAROSSA 1000 9413 | 06:00 Berlin Brandenburg Airport | 8h48 | 14:48 Naples Centrale | 3 changes | |
LH1959 · LH1866+ Regionale 20693+ Intercity 511 | 06:00 Berlin Brandenburg Airport | 13h29 | 19:29 Naples Centrale | 3 changes | |
LH1959 · LH1866+ Leonardo express 4617+ FRECCIAROSSA 9311 | 06:00 Berlin Brandenburg Airport | 8h03 | 14:03 Naples Centrale | 3 changes | |
LH1959 · LH1866+ LH5122 | 06:00 Berlin Brandenburg Airport | 7h20 | 13:20 Naples International Airport | 2 changes | |
LX963+ LX3438+ Regionale 20693+ Intercity 511 | 06:15 Berlin Brandenburg Airport | 13h14 | 19:29 Naples Centrale | 3 changes | |
LX963 · LX1710 | 06:15 Berlin Brandenburg Airport | 6h55 | 13:10 Naples International Airport | 1 change | |
LX963+ LX3438+ Leonardo express 4623+ FRECCIAROSSA 1000 9413 | 06:15 Berlin Brandenburg Airport | 8h33 | 14:48 Naples Centrale | 3 changes | |
LX963+ LX3438+ Regionale 20731+ Intercity 597 | 06:15 Berlin Brandenburg Airport | 16h19 | 22:34 Naples Centrale | 3 changes | |
LH175 · LH232+ Regionale 20731+ Intercity 597 | 06:40 Berlin Brandenburg Airport | 15h54 | 22:34 Naples Centrale | 3 changes | |
LH175 · LH232+ Leonardo express 4641+ FRECCIAROSSA 8343 | 06:40 Berlin Brandenburg Airport | 10h43 | 17:23 Naples Centrale | 3 changes | |
LH175 · LH232+ Regionale 20693+ Intercity 511 | 06:40 Berlin Brandenburg Airport | 12h49 | 19:29 Naples Centrale | 3 changes | |
LH177 · LH232+ Leonardo express 4641+ FRECCIAROSSA 8343 | 07:40 Berlin Brandenburg Airport | 9h43 | 17:23 Naples Centrale | 3 changes | |
LH177 · LH232+ Regionale 20731+ Intercity 597 | 07:40 Berlin Brandenburg Airport | 14h54 | 22:34 Naples Centrale | 3 changes | |
LH177 · LH232+ Regionale 20693+ Intercity 511 | 07:40 Berlin Brandenburg Airport | 11h49 | 19:29 Naples Centrale | 3 changes | |
LH4079+ LH1868+ Regionale 20731+ Intercity 597 | 08:00 Berlin Brandenburg Airport | 14h34 | 22:34 Naples Centrale | 3 changes | |
LH4079+ LH1868+ Regionale 20693+ Intercity 511 | 08:00 Berlin Brandenburg Airport | 11h29 | 19:29 Naples Centrale | 3 changes | |
FR 9164+ V71621 | 08:00 Berlin Brandenburg Airport | 8h20 | 16:20 Naples International Airport | 1 change | |
LH4079 · LH4144 | 08:00 Berlin Brandenburg Airport | 3h30 | 11:30 Naples International Airport | 1 change | |
U24265 | 08:35 Berlin Brandenburg Airport | 2h10 | 10:45 Naples International Airport | 0 changesdirect | |
LX975+ LX1736+ Regionale 20731+ Intercity 597 | 08:40 Berlin Brandenburg Airport | 13h54 | 22:34 Naples Centrale | 3 changes | |
LX975 · LX1710 | 08:40 Berlin Brandenburg Airport | 4h30 | 13:10 Naples International Airport | 1 change | |
LX975+ LX1736+ Regionale 20693+ Intercity 511 | 08:40 Berlin Brandenburg Airport | 10h49 | 19:29 Naples Centrale | 3 changes | |
LX975+ LX1736+ Leonardo express 4641+ FRECCIAROSSA 8343 | 08:40 Berlin Brandenburg Airport | 8h43 | 17:23 Naples Centrale | 3 changes | |
SK1674 · SK2681 | 09:10 Berlin Brandenburg Airport | 10h25 | 19:35 Naples International Airport | 1 change | |
VY1883 · VY6502 | 09:45 Berlin Brandenburg Airport | 10h55 | 20:40 Naples International Airport | 1 change | |
SK2678 · SK1841+ Regionale 20731+ Intercity 597 | 10:00 Berlin Brandenburg Airport | 12h34 | 22:34 Naples Centrale | 3 changes | |
SK2678 · SK1841+ Leonardo express 4675+ FRECCIAROSSA 9657 | 10:00 Berlin Brandenburg Airport | 12h03 | 22:03 Naples Centrale | 3 changes | |
SK2678 · SK1841+ Leonardo express 4707+ FRECCIAROSSA 9325 | 10:00 Berlin Brandenburg Airport | 11h03 | 21:03 Naples Centrale | 3 changes | |
LH185 · LH336 | 10:40 Berlin Brandenburg Airport | 6h35 | 17:15 Naples International Airport | 1 change | |
SN2582 · SN3181+ Leonardo express 4667+ FRECCIAROSSA 8525 | 10:55 Berlin Brandenburg Airport | 9h38 | 20:33 Naples Centrale | 3 changes | |
SN2582 · SN3181+ Regionale 20731+ Intercity 597 | 10:55 Berlin Brandenburg Airport | 11h39 | 22:34 Naples Centrale | 3 changes | |
SN2582 · SN3181+ Leonardo express 4659+ FRECCIAROSSA 1000 9427 | 10:55 Berlin Brandenburg Airport | 8h53 | 19:48 Naples Centrale | 3 changes | |
LH187+ LH236+ Regionale 20731+ Intercity 597 | 11:40 Berlin Brandenburg Airport | 10h54 | 22:34 Naples Centrale | 3 changes | |
LH187+ LH236+ Leonardo express 4667+ FRECCIAROSSA 8525 | 11:40 Berlin Brandenburg Airport | 8h53 | 20:33 Naples Centrale | 3 changes | |
LH187+ LH236+ Leonardo express 4707+ FRECCIAROSSA 9325 | 11:40 Berlin Brandenburg Airport | 9h23 | 21:03 Naples Centrale | 3 changes | |
LH187 · LH336 | 11:40 Berlin Brandenburg Airport | 5h35 | 17:15 Naples International Airport | 1 change | |
This is the last flight of the day. | |||||
Find all the dates and times for this journey
How far in advance should I book flight tickets from Berlin to Naples?
Compare prices and tickets Berlin to Naples by train, coach or flight
Compare train, coach and flight prices over the next three weeks. See the best deals at a glance, find the lowest fares, and choose the option that fits your budget.
21 Dec
22 Dec
23 Dec
24 Dec
25 Dec
26 Dec
27 Dec
28 Dec
29 Dec
30 Dec
31 Dec
01 Jan
02 Jan
03 Jan
04 Jan
05 Jan
06 Jan
07 Jan
08 Jan
09 Jan
10 Jan
Airlines: easyJet, Lufthansa, Eurowings , Austrian Airlines, Lufthansa Cityline, SWISS, KLM, Air France, Vueling Airlines, Brussels Airlines from Berlin to NaplesFind the best flights between Berlin to Naples with Omio's travel partners easyJet, Lufthansa, Eurowings , Austrian Airlines, Lufthansa Cityline, SWISS, KLM, Air France, Vueling Airlines, Brussels Airlines from £67. We can find you the best deals, schedules and tickets when comparing and booking the best trip.
Lufthansa
Austrian Airlines
Lufthansa Cityline
SWISS
Air France
Eurowings
KLM
Vueling Airlines
Brussels Airlines
easyJet
Berlin to Naples Flights: An Overview
Naples is a gritty city, set on the coast of Italy's Campania region. From an incredible food culture to dramatic volcanic views of Mt. Vesuvius, Naples is a vibrant and bustling metropolis, attracting millions of visitors every year. Those wanting to travel from Berlin to Naples will find regular and convenient flights between the two cities. On average, direct flights take three hours 30 minutes to travel the 1,302 kilometers between the German capital and Naples. Although there are only a few direct flights per day, services with a stopover or change are also fairly quick, with average flight durations of 4-7 hours. These services run regularly throughout the day, from early morning until evening, and are reasonably priced, providing extra options for potential travelers.
Which Airlines fly from Berlin to Naples?
Airlines that regularly fly this route include easyJet, Ryanair, Eurowings, Alitalia, Iberia, and Germanwings. The only carriers to offer regular direct flights are the budget airlines easyJet and Ryanair. Indirect flights are more readily available, with plenty of airlines offering a range of flights.
How long is the flight from Berlin to Naples?
Journeys on this route can be fairly quick, if they are direct or with short stopover times and few changes. On average, direct flights between Berlin and Naples take around two hours 15 minutes in total. Indirect flights are more frequent but will take slightly longer. Flights with one stopover can take anywhere from 4-8 hours, depending on the location of the change and the length of the stopover. In situations where the time between flights is long, journeys on this route can take upwards of 11 hours. It is recommended that passengers check flight durations before booking.
How many flights are there from Berlin to Naples?
Every day there are over 100 flights from Berlin to Naples. Passengers looking for direct flights should expect to see at least two available flights every day of the week, one in the morning and one early in the afternoon. There are around 10 indirect flights every day with a duration of under eight hours, leaving passengers with plenty of options for a fast journey.
What are the departure and arrival airports for flights from Berlin to Naples?
Departure airport: departures on this route take-off from either Berlin Tegel or Berlin Schoenefeld. Flights from budget airlines like easyJet fly from Berlin Schoenefeld, located 20 kilometers from Berlin city center. Passengers can access the airport from the city center using the airport express train, which should take around 40 minutes. Berlin Tegel is closer to the city, and a bus journey will take around 35 minutes to arrive at the airport. Both airports have long or short stay parking lots, restaurants, bars, duty-free shopping, WiFi, and power outlets for charging electrical devices.
Arrival airport: Flights arrive in Naples International Airport, located around 7kilometers from the city center. The easiest way to reach the city center is to travel by the local Alibus, which takes approximately 20 minutes to reach downtown. Services by Alibus are available every day of the week including holidays. Services in Naples International Airport include car rental desks, charging ports for electrical devices, and free WiFi throughout.
FAQs: Berlin to Naples flights
Find answers to the most common questions about traveling from Berlin to Naples by flight. From journey times and ticket prices to direct connections, first and last departures, and even whether the route is scenic, our FAQs cover everything you need to plan your trip. Whether you’re looking for the fastest flight, the cheapest option, or tips for making the most of your visit at Naples, this guide helps you travel smarter and with confidence.

Flights from Berlin to Naples generally leave from Berlin Brandenburg Airport and arrive in Naples International Airport.
Berlin Brandenburg Airport is 25.8 km away from Berlin city centre and Naples International Airport is 10.3 km from Naples city centre.
popular airports
Important Stations and Airports in Berlin and Naples
- Free Wi-Fi available throughout the airport.
- Shops in Terminal 1, including duty-free and fashion stores.
- Parking available near terminals, approximately 5€ per hour.
- Available outside the terminal.
- Elevators, ramps.
- Available throughout the airport.
- Yes
- Lounges available in Terminal 1, including Lufthansa Lounge.
- In Terminal 1, Level U1.
- Bus: X7, X71, 163, 164, 171, 744
- Train: FEX, RE7, RB14
- Metro: U7
- Free Wi-Fi available throughout the airport.
- Shops are available in both terminals, including duty-free and local specialty stores.
- Parking available with short-term and long-term options, short-term parking approximately 3€ per hour.
- Available outside the terminal.
- Elevators.
- Available throughout the airport, including accessible facilities.
- Yes
- Lounges available, including the Caruso Lounge, with entry fees or membership.
- Located in the arrivals area, contact airport staff for assistance.
- Bus: Alibus, 182, 3S
More options for your journey from Berlin to Naples
Here are some other resources that might have the information you need











